Find the slope of the line that passes through (10, 9) and (3, 18).
MakcuM [25]

Answer: Slope of the line is -9/7

Step-by-step explanation:

Given :

Points : (10,9) and (3,18)

Now slope of line when two points are given

m=\frac{y2-y1}{x2-x1}

Slope = \frac{18-9}{3-10}

m=\frac{9}{-7}

m=\frac{-9}{7}

This is an improper fraction since numerator is greater than the denominator

Hence slope of the line is -9/7

I need help with part b. I feel like there’s a catch, I want to do the first derivative test, however, I feel like there is a be
Sladkaya [172]

Answer:

The fifth degree Taylor polynomial of g(x) is increasing around x=-1

Step-by-step explanation:

Yes, you can do the derivative of the fifth degree Taylor polynomial, but notice that its derivative evaluated at x =-1 will give zero for all its terms except for the one of first order, so the calculation becomes simple:

P_5(x)=g(-1)+g'(-1)\,(x+1)+g"(-1)\, \frac{(x+1)^2}{2!} +g^{(3)}(-1)\, \frac{(x+1)^3}{3!} + g^{(4)}(-1)\, \frac{(x+1)^4}{4!} +g^{(5)}(-1)\, \frac{(x+1)^5}{5!}

and when you do its derivative:

1) the constant term renders zero,

2) the following term (term of order 1, the linear term) renders: g'(-1)\,(1) since the derivative of (x+1) is one,

3) all other terms will keep at least one factor (x+1) in their derivative, and this evaluated at x = -1 will render zero

Therefore, the only term that would give you something different from zero once evaluated at x = -1 is the derivative of that linear term. and that only non-zero term is: g'(-1)= 7 as per the information given. Therefore, the function has derivative larger than zero, then it is increasing in the vicinity of x = -1
